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
989104401 1464370 900428
2005 806842417
2005 806842417
34 4104576362 88 95
All about undefined
Interested in learning more?
2005 806842417
34 4104576362 88 95
See more
872791345 3095358 1165674637
20 0334 48736 717 135646063
See more
50472799 96 345245
6198167735 140206 904
See more